What is Curtain Walling?
Curtain walling is a non-structural external facade system designed to cover the exterior of commercial buildings using aluminium framing and glazed panels.
These systems create a lightweight external envelope that protects the building from weather exposure while allowing large areas of glazing, as this improves natural light and architectural appearance.
Since curtain wall systems are separate from the structural framework of the building, they reduce external wall loading while maintaining durability and weather resistance.
As modern glazed facades improve energy efficiency and visual presentation, curtain walling is widely used in office buildings, retail centres, and commercial developments.

How Much Does Curtain Walling Installation Cost in Biggleswade?
Curtain walling installation in Biggleswade costs between £450 and £1,800+ per square metre.
The cost of hiring curtain walling specialists depends on glazing specification, facade complexity, structural requirements, and access conditions.
The cost is influenced by glazing type, aluminium systems, thermal performance requirements, building height, and bespoke architectural features.
Since smaller commercial glazing projects require simpler facade systems and reduced installation scope, basic curtain walling installations may range from £450 to £800 per square metre.
Mid-range commercial facade systems typically cost between £800 and £1,200 per square metre, since larger glazed areas and specialist thermal systems increase project scope.
As high-rise commercial buildings, luxury developments, and bespoke architectural facades require advanced engineering and specialist installation methods, costs can exceed £1,200 to £1,800+ per square metre.

Is Curtain Walling Energy Efficient?
Curtain walling installation can significantly improve building energy efficiency when modern thermal glazing systems are used.
Double glazing, thermal breaks, solar control glass, and insulated aluminium systems reduce heat transfer and improve environmental performance, as this helps lower energy consumption within commercial buildings.

Are Curtain Walling Systems Weather-Resistant?
Curtain walling systems in Biggleswade are specifically designed to provide weather resistance and environmental protection for commercial buildings.
Modern glazing systems include sealed joints, drainage channels, and weatherproof aluminium framing, as this prevents water ingress and protects against wind exposure.

Does Curtain Walling Require Maintenance?
Curtain walling installations in Biggleswade benefit from regular inspections and maintenance to preserve appearance and operational performance.
Routine glass cleaning, seal inspections, drainage maintenance, and structural checks help maintain facade reliability and visual quality, as this prevents long-term deterioration and performance issues.
